Transaction 58f2e56ccefa74f0925d03fd2abd4ffbfc10291355fbffc95a5192d1a19f2420

1 Input
2 Outputs
  • 58f2e56ccefa74f0925d03fd2abd4ffbfc10291355fbffc95a5192d1a19f2420:0
  • value  300000
    address  185mu2Gasaw1b9cJGUsoNMB8Ne2VK4JwyY
  • 58f2e56ccefa74f0925d03fd2abd4ffbfc10291355fbffc95a5192d1a19f2420:1
  • value  84394229
    address  1Aif85BvsoBvsk2BstFT1jZzwA4jYghano